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
610552194 4404 787159267 93012030220 954568623
58545090929 96234924104
58545090929 96234924104
2817 1310 2412030918 891623
All about undefined
Interested in learning more?
58545090929 96234924104
2817 1310 2412030918 891623
See more
869627 391
6237605 7980 265
See more
486307053 717 239
4472 560 6319497838
See more